Create refreshing, healthier drinks, from kombucha to herbal sodas and more, in your own kitchen.
Since the relatively recent introduction of kombucha onto North American supermarket shelves, this healthy sparkling beverage has exploded in popularity. But can it be brewed at home, with the same tasty, healthy results?
With this straightforward, accessible, and highly visual how-to guide, author Andrea Potter does away with specialist jargon and expensive or hard-to-find equipment, showing how sparkling homebrews from kombucha to water kefir are definitely possible for just about anyone to make, and have fun doing it. Coverage includes:
• Basic fermentation science • Controlling fizz, acidity, and alcohol content • Secondary fermentation and adding flavours to the brew • Wild-fermented sodas, using a ginger bug (a wild yeast culture) • Recipes for kombucha's honey-fed relative, Jun, as well as for water kefir.
Answering key questions including "where does all that sugar go?", "do I need to get a sitter for it when I go on holiday?", and "does this SCOBY look normal?", and including a comprehensive troubleshooting guide to help you keep brewing confidently and consistently, DIY Kombucha is ideal for foodies, urban and rural homesteaders, and health-motivated people - it's an essential addition to your DIY toolkit!
